Output 0428d41d79defcc05a817a2b8c35d6a4ad64b53c8244256ad64f39d69de6bf18:3

value
14497195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5baa1086f09cf0b622b5ee929b10a17f73dcc45 OP_EQUAL
address
3MB7RchXNoYkPR4Xxv34qzd7awEuZPQm2Y
transaction
0428d41d79defcc05a817a2b8c35d6a4ad64b53c8244256ad64f39d69de6bf18
spent
true